Names and origin
| Protein names | Recommended name: Putative alpha-amylase EC=3.2.1.1 | ||
| Gene names |
| ||
| Organism | Methanocaldococcus jannaschii (Methanococcus jannaschii) [Complete proteome] [HAMAP] | ||
| Taxonomic identifier | 2190 [NCBI] | ||
| Taxonomic lineage | Archaea › Euryarchaeota › Methanococci › Methanococcales › Methanocaldococcaceae › Methanocaldococcus |
Protein attributes
| Sequence length | 467 AA. |
| Sequence status | Complete. |
| Sequence processing | The displayed sequence is not processed. |
| Protein existence | Inferred from homology. |
General annotation (Comments)
| Catalytic activity | Endohydrolysis of (1->4)-alpha-D-glucosidic linkages in oligosaccharides and polysaccharides. |
| Sequence similarities | Belongs to the glycosyl hydrolase 57 family. |
